How we quote
Every project is quoted in writing after the conversation, with the scope, the deliverables, the revision count, the timeline and the payment terms all stated before anything begins.
We do not publish fixed package prices, because the same brief can be a two-week job or a three-month one depending on what already exists. What you get instead is a number before you commit, and a scope you can put side by side with anyone else's proposal.
A portion of the fee is payable in advance to start work; the rest follows the schedule in the quotation.
If we are not the right fit
Sometimes the honest answer is that the work you are asking for will not solve the problem you have, that the budget does not match the goal attached to it, or that a smaller piece of work first would serve you better.
We would rather say that at the quote stage than three months into a retainer. It costs us a project occasionally and saves everyone a great deal more than that.
